              • I ended up going one of these has the Capacitive screen and is android based seems ok so far just getting used to android but fitting was not to hard cost 380.00 delivered with a reversing camera was about 7 days from order to delivery with the fedex option

                just added Sygic gps app cost about 37.00 and the Hema app another 50.00 and a 8 gig sd card 15.00 and a Toyota ISO cable from super cheap 15.00 to connect the unit still had to solder but atleast I did not butcher the original stereo plug on the car put in a better file manager total command and they all installed and run ok

                  • Bit of an update with my digoptions unit...

                    Yeah still works OK but i found the screen went ballistic a while ago....the touch didnt work etc. I swore at it for about 20 mins before the mrs got a cloth out and cleaned the screen....hey presto worked fine again. i think you have to keep that screen spotless or it gets confused.

                    As for boot up time mine is pretty quick to be fair - probably about 5 seconds? Its not instant but good enough.

                    Radio reception is still crap tho...

                    the source button stays red but i think its designed that way and i kinda like it. Actually i really like the way it looks like its a factory install rather than some 'supa kool fully sik ICE unit innit bruv' with heaps of 'bling'. (jeez 15 years ago i would have loved all that crap)

                    My oziexplorer is fine. ive loaded it up with HEMA maps too and used it on a few journeys. No issues crashing although it did freeze once after i first installed it - never since.

                    I think at the end of the day its about expectations. Its a budget $500 unit. so its going to work like a budget $500 unit - clunky, maybe a bit slow etc. If you want something better its going to cost more. Im only running it as it was cheap and i wanted the ozi explorer and a rear view camera. Its been fine so far and once it shits itself ill go and get an android based unit as MS CE is ancient!

                    • just an update on the Oziexplorer side of things.

                      I found it an absolute pig to use. Its really complex and powerful but is a mission to use whilst on the run. Came across the exploreOz 'skin' for it for only $10 on the website. I have installed that and now its brilliant! really simple to use...kinda like a HEMA layout.

                      Unit is still going OK(touch wood)...actually its going a bit better since an update i got sent by Matthew.
